Handover: Checkout load testing on Fenwick Pay

Welcome aboard. Before running any load tests against the Fenwick checkout flow, please read the staging notes carefully. We ramp virtual users slowly — the payment stub in staging throttles at modest rates, and overshooting skews latency numbers. Always warm the cart cache first, and never point the harness at the shared sandbox on Tuesdays (reconciliation runs then). The exact settings the harness expects for the staging environment are listed below.

settings of fafog-haduf:
ZORIX_PIN=4648
ZORIX_METRICS_HOST=metrics.zorix.paliqsys.corp
ZORIX_LOG_LEVEL=info
ZORIX_TENANT=druix

## Escalation: SDK Parity Issues

So you've found a case where the Lumabridge Java SDK does something the Go SDK doesn't (or vice versa). First, check the parity matrix in the Driftnote wiki — some gaps are intentional and documented. If it's not listed, file a parity ticket with a minimal repro in both languages. Don't just patch one side quietly; that's how we got here. For anything blocking a customer, email the SDK leads right away.

alerts address for yahof-kahof: praion_fraius_beldor@halixsoft.internal

Since Saturday's match, the Gatewise turnstile counter at Halverton Arena has dropped its database connection roughly every twenty minutes, losing tally batches. The counter retries but occasionally double-posts entries on reconnect. Please check the pooling settings first: the on-site gateway should hold no more than four persistent connections, and idle timeout must exceed the venue network's NAT timeout. To reproduce the failure in the lab, configure your test rig with the following connection string.

replica DSN, yahaf-yagaf: mongodb://tamath_svc:a2netSk3RZMuTj@db-d084.novacsoft.internal:5432/ralmir